> The API you need is the updateVirtualMachine API for release 4.2 or 4.3 (this is a 4.2 feature so will not be in the 4.0 API docs)  http://cloudstack.apache.org/docs/api/apidocs-4.3/root_admin/updateVirtualMachine.html
> 
> When a VM is deployed, it takes the dynamicallyscalable setting from the Template, so you cannot control this via the deployVirtualMachine
> 
> The updaateVirtualMachine API allows you to deploy a VM from an ISO, then after deployment update it to make it dynamic etc.

> Dear all,
> 
> I would like to enable the dynamically scalable property of a Virtual machine at creation time. Is it possible ? I checked the parameters in the API but I cannot find any parameters that enables this feature. However, I can do it manually using the UI, if I edit the machine enabling the dynamically scalable property and then saving the changes.
> 
> This is the API call, I was looking at … http://cloudstack.apache.org/docs/api/apidocs-4.0.0/user/deployVirtualMachine.html
